Subject: Heads-up on the Hedging Call

Hi all,

Welcome context for our incoming director: last week we settled the debate and committed to hedging 55% of Pellmark Foods' oskar-denominated revenue through next fiscal year. Not everyone loved it — the treasury folks wanted 75% — but the board favored keeping some upside. Instruments are standard forwards, reviewed monthly. I'll walk through the mechanics at Thursday's sync. For now, the key thing to absorb is the strategic intent captured below.

management briefing: Project Ulavan slips by two quarters because of the staffing delay.

Quarterly Planning Note — Norfell Plant Capacity

Sales leads: after reviewing demand forecasts for the Arqo valve series, management has approved a second shift at the Norfell plant rather than outsourcing to Greyhaven Fabrication. Lead times should shorten from nine weeks to six by mid-quarter. Please quote accordingly and avoid committing to expedited slots until the shift is fully staffed. The confidential planning detail governing larger commitments appears immediately below.

internal memo for hahif-hahaf: Headcount on the Zorwyn team goes from 9 to 100 by the end of October. Gross margin on Zorwyn came in at 5 percent against a plan of 10 percent.

Dear Executive Team,

I am requesting an incremental allocation of 1.4m for the Hartvale modernisation programme. The current Ombric stack is nearing end of support, and maintenance costs rose 22% year over year. The request covers migration tooling, two contract engineers for six months, and a contingency of 10%. Heads of department should note the phased plan avoids any freeze on customer-facing work. Decision needed before the planning cycle closes. The strategic context, for your eyes only, follows below.

board note of fahif-yahog: Gross margin on Wenath came in at 10 percent against a plan of 5 percent. Only 3 of the 100 pilot accounts renewed Wenath, so a churn review is set for July 15.